Understanding Game Mechanics and Odds

Before diving into any casino game, taking the time to understand its underlying mechanics and associated odds is paramount. Each game operates with a different set of rules and probabilities, and knowing these details can significantly impact your strategy. For instance, in games like blackjack, the house edge can be minimized through strategic play, such as understanding when to hit, stand, split, or double down. Similarly, in poker, recognizing hand rankings and employing basic strategic principles can be the difference between winning and losing.

Don't assume all games are created equal. Slot machines, while visually appealing and easy to play, often have a higher house edge compared to table games. Video poker, on the other hand, can offer relatively good odds, especially for players who learn optimal strategies. Researching various games and understanding their specific advantages and disadvantages is a fundamental step towards informed gameplay. The Importance of Return to Player (RTP)

A critical factor to consider when selecting a casino game is its Return to Player (RTP) percentage. RTP represents the average percentage of wagered money that a game is expected to return to players over an extended period. A higher RTP indicates a more favorable game for the player, as it suggests a lower house edge. Generally, games with an RTP of 96% or higher are considered good choices. However, remember that RTP is a theoretical value calculated over millions of spins or hands, and your individual results may vary.

Finding the RTP information for a specific game can sometimes be tricky, as it's not always prominently displayed. However, many online casinos and game developers publish this information in their game documentation or on their websites. Taking the time to locate and compare RTP percentages across different games can help you make more informed decisions about where to spend your money. Always verify the information from a reliable source.

Game TypeTypical RTP RangeHouse Edge
Slot Machines 85% – 98% 2% – 15%
Blackjack (Optimal Play) 99.5% 0.5%
Roulette (European) 97.3% 2.7%
Video Poker (Jacks or Better) 99.5% 0.5%

Understanding RTP is just one piece of the puzzle. It's vital to remember that RTP doesn’t guarantee short-term wins. It’s a long-term average, and individual sessions can deviate significantly from this value. Still, knowing the RTP helps you choose games that offer a better overall chance of earning a return on your investment.

Bankroll Management: The Key to Sustainable Play

Effective bankroll management is arguably the most crucial aspect of successful casino gaming. It involves setting a budget for your gambling activities and adhering to it strictly. This prevents you from chasing losses and potentially depleting your funds. A common rule of thumb is to only gamble with money you can afford to lose, and to allocate a specific percentage of your overall income to gambling. Treat your bankroll as an investment, and approach it with a disciplined mindset.

Avoid the temptation to increase your bets in an attempt to recover losses quickly. This is a classic mistake known as "chasing losses" and often leads to even greater financial hardship. Instead, stick to a predetermined bet size, based on your bankroll and risk tolerance. Consider using a staking plan, such as the Martingale system (doubling your bet after each loss), but be aware that these systems are not foolproof and can lead to significant losses if not implemented responsibly. It's often better to adopt a more conservative approach, focusing on consistent, smaller bets.

Setting Limits and Sticking to Them

Setting both deposit limits and loss limits is essential for responsible gaming. Deposit limits rest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your casino account over a specific period, preventing you from overspending. Loss limits define the maximum amount of money you’re willing to lose in a single session or over a longer timeframe. Once you reach your loss limit, stop playing, regardless of whether you feel like you are ‘due’ a win. These limits act as safeguards against impulsive decisions and help maintain control over your spending.

Most reputable online casinos offer tools to help players set and manage these limits. Take advantage of these features and customize them to your individual needs and financial situation. If you find yourself repeatedly exceeding your limits, it may be a sign that you need to reassess your gambling habits and seek help if necessary. Remember, the goal is to enjoy the experience responsibly, not to chase unsustainable wins.

Leveraging Bonuses and Promotions

Online casinos frequently offer bonuses and promotions to attract new players and reward existing ones. These can range from welcome bonuses and deposit matches to free spins and cashback offers. While these offers can be beneficial, it's crucial to understand the associated terms and conditions before claiming them.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which specify the amount you need to bet before you can withdraw any winnings generated from the bonus.

Wagering requirements can vary significantly from casino to casino. Some casinos may have relatively low wagering requirements, while others may impose much stricter conditions. It’s also important to check any game restrictions associated with the bonus. Some bonuses may only be valid for specific games, while others may exclude certain games altogether. Don't be fooled by overly generous-sounding bonuses without reading the fine print. An unrealistic bonus with impossible wagering requirements is often less valuable than a smaller bonus with reasonable conditions.

Understanding Wagering Requirements

Wagering requirements are often exp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that you need to b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. Therefore, if you receive a $100 bonus with a 30x wagering requirement, you need to wager $3,000 before being eligible for a withdrawal. This can be a significant hurdle, so it’s crucial to factor it into your decision-making process.

Consider your playing style and the types of games you enjoy when evaluating a bonus. If you primarily play low-volatility games, such as slots with a high RTP, it may be easier to meet the wagering requirements. However, if you prefer high-volatility games, such as jackpot slots, you may find it more challenging. The Psychological Aspects of Casino Gaming

Casino gaming can be highly stimulating and emotionally charged. The flashing lights, exciting sounds, and potential for winning can create a sense of excitement and anticipation. However, it's crucial to be aware of the psychological factors that can influence your decision-making process. Cognitive biases, such as the gambler's fallacy (the belief that past events influence future outcomes in random games) and the near-miss effect (feeling encouraged by narrowly missing a win), can lead to irrational behavior.

Maintaining emotional control is essential for making sound decisions. Avoid gambling when you're feeling stressed, angry, or upset, as these emotions can impair your judgment. Recognize that losses are an inevitable part of gambling and accept them gracefully. Don't allow your emotions to drive your betting decisions, and stick to your predetermined strategy. Take regular breaks to clear your head and maintain a realistic perspective.
